Detailed information for compound 1071713

Basic information

Technical information
  • Name: Unnamed compound
  • MW: 367.312 | Formula: C16H19FN3O4P
  • H donors: 3 H acceptors: 4 LogP: 1.75 Rotable bonds: 5
    Rule of 5 violations (Lipinski): 1
  • SMILES: CCC(n1c(nc2c1ccc(c2N)F)c1ccc(o1)P(=O)(O)O)CC
  • InChi: 1S/C16H19FN3O4P/c1-3-9(4-2)20-11-6-5-10(17)14(18)15(11)19-16(20)12-7-8-13(24-12)25(21,22)23/h5-9H,3-4,18H2,1-2H3,(H2,21,22,23)
  • InChiKey: ZFKDVPHSRBHRBJ-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
IC50 (binding) = 0.85 uM Inhibition of human liver FBPase 1 ChEMBL. 20055427
IC50 (binding) = 2.5 uM Inhibition of rat liver FBPase 1 ChEMBL. 20055427
